Transaction ed9672ca62a7e4c6b1c3f987291c8039d9e505efee10e3d908d17a2180f8a2a5
1 Input
2 Outputs
- ed9672ca62a7e4c6b1c3f987291c8039d9e505efee10e3d908d17a2180f8a2a5:0
- ed9672ca62a7e4c6b1c3f987291c8039d9e505efee10e3d908d17a2180f8a2a5:1
value 5705743
address 18fcserSSPw3yFmBk2ToMGrLMNfTbgG7iE
value 7815620260
address 1HGYwg2BY5Z1YHkpLHH3d7pTjM9pFakZhJ